システム開発のUAT(ユーザー受け入れテスト)とは?成功するためのステップとポイント

開発
この記事は約5分で読めます。
スポンサーリンク

システム開発において、UAT(ユーザー受け入れテスト)は最終段階で実施される非常に重要なプロセスです。UATを通じて、システムが業務要件を満たし、ユーザーの期待に応えるかどうかを確認します。本記事では、UATの基本から実施方法、成功事例と失敗事例までを詳しく解説します。

UATの基本とその重要性

1-1. UATとは?

UAT(ユーザー受け入れテスト)は、システム開発の最終段階で行われるテストであり、実際のユーザーがシステムを操作して確認するプロセスです。開発チームではなく、エンドユーザーがテストを実施することで、実際の使用環境下での問題点を洗い出し、システムが業務要件を満たしているかどうかを確認します。

1-2. UATの目的

UATの主な目的は、システムがユーザーの期待に応えるかどうかを確認することです。これにより、システムリリース後のトラブルを未然に防ぐことができます。また、ユーザーの視点から見た使い勝手や業務フローの適合性も評価されます。

UATの準備

2-1. テスト計画の作成

効果的なUATを実施するためには、詳細なテスト計画が不可欠です。テスト計画には、テストの目的、範囲、スケジュール、担当者、使用するツールなどが含まれます。特に、どの業務フローをテストするか、どのようなシナリオを使用するかを明確にすることが重要です。

2-2. テスト環境の準備

UATを実施するためには、本番環境に近いテスト環境を用意する必要があります。これにより、実際の使用条件に近い形でテストを行うことができ、より現実的なフィードバックを得ることができます。テスト環境には、必要なハードウェア、ソフトウェア、データなどが含まれます。

UATの実施

3-1. テストの進行管理

UATの進行管理は、プロジェクトマネージャーやテストリーダーが担当します。彼らはテストの進行状況を確認し、遅延が発生した場合はスケジュールを調整します。また、テストの進行に伴い、必要に応じて計画を見直し、問題が発生した場合には迅速に対応します。

3-2. 効果的なテストケースの作成

UATの効果を最大化するためには、多様なテストケースを作成することが重要です。機能テスト、性能テスト、セキュリティテストなど、様々な視点からシステムを評価します。特に、実際の業務シナリオを反映したテストケースを作成することで、ユーザーが日常的に行う操作が問題なく行えるかを確認できます。

UATの結果と評価

4-1. UAT結果の分析方法

UATの結果を正確に評価するためには、データの収集が重要です。テスト中に発生した問題やエラーのログを詳細に記録し、全てのテストケースの結果を集計します。収集したデータを分析する際には、問題の発生頻度や影響度を評価します。これにより、重大な問題を優先的に修正し、システムの品質を向上させることができます。

4-2. UATのフィードバックと修正

UAT後には、テストに参加したユーザーからフィードバックを受け取ります。フィードバックを受け取る際には、具体的な問題点や改善点を明確にし、開発チームに伝えることが重要です。フィードバックを基に修正を行った後、再度UATを実施します。再テストを通じて、修正が適切に行われたかを確認し、全ての問題が解決されたことを確かめます。

UATの成功事例と失敗事例

5-1. 成功事例から学ぶポイント

ある企業のUAT成功事例では、徹底した事前準備と詳細なテスト計画が功を奏しました。ユーザーのフィードバックを基にした修正が迅速に行われ、システムリリース後のトラブルを未然に防ぐことができました。この成功事例の要因としては、ユーザーの視点を重視したテストケースの作成、綿密な進行管理、そして迅速なフィードバック対応が挙げられます。

5-2. 失敗事例から学ぶ注意点

一方で、ある企業ではUATが不十分だったため、システムリリース後に多数のバグが発見されました。これは、テストケースが不完全であったことや、ユーザーのフィードバックが適切に反映されなかったことが原因です。失敗の原因としては、テスト計画の不備、フィードバックの無視、そしてスケジュールの甘さが挙げられます。これらを避けるためには、事前の準備と計画が重要であり、ユーザーの意見を尊重することが必要です。

FAQ

Q. UATを実施する際の最も重要なポイントは何ですか?

A. UATを成功させるための最も重要なポイントは、事前の準備と詳細なテスト計画です。これにより、テストの進行がスムーズになり、効果的なフィードバックが得られます。

Q. UATの実施期間はどのくらいですか?

A. UATの実施期間はプロジェクトの規模や複雑さによりますが、通常は数週間から1ヶ月程度が一般的です。スケジュールを適切に設定し、全てのテストケースを網羅することが重要です。

Q. UATの結果が不十分だった場合、どうすればよいですか?

A. UATの結果が不十分だった場合は、フィードバックを基に修正を行い、再度テストを実施する必要があります。問題が解決されるまで、テストと修正を繰り返すことが重要です。

まとめ

UAT(ユーザー受け入れテスト)は、システム開発の最終段階で欠かせないプロセスです。UATを通じて、システムが業務要件を満たし、ユーザーの期待に応えるかどうかを確認します。事前準備と詳細なテスト計画、ユーザーのフィードバックを重視した進行管理が重要です。これにより、システムの品質を向上させ、リリース後のトラブルを未然に防ぐことができます。UATを成功させるためのポイントを押さえ、システム開発を円滑に進めましょう。

次世代のソフトウェア開発をお手伝いいたします

当社の専門チームが、最新技術を駆使して、プロジェクトの円滑な進行をサポートいたします。
また、お客様のビジネスニーズに合わせて、最適なカスタムソフトウェアを開発いたします。
お気軽にご相談ください!

開発
シェアする
スポンサーリンク